Full description
Gosh, this one has proved difficult to date. Careful examination of the style and the colours used, plus me picking a date at complete random, means I've settled for 1450-1500AD. Without any evidence I've also decided it was made in North Italy. Anyway, It's a double candlestick and shows the potter's favourite cat that they constantly tripped over in the dark until they made the candlestick.
This is an original drawing, it is not a print. It is drawn on A4 3oogm acid free paper using Staedtler pigment pens and coloured using artist quality acrylic paints. The black border is 215mm x 130mm and the drawing is 170mm x 105mm. It is supplied unframed.
